Heat dissipation application of thermal silica sheet
The street lamp works for a long time, if the heat dissipation is not good, the service life will not be too long! How to use thermal silica gel to dissipate heat in LED street lights?
 
1. Thermally conductive silicone sheet: a thermally conductive filler material with high thermal conductivity and high performance, mainly used between the chip and the heat sink or shell of electronic heating products.
2, characteristics: with its own slightly viscous, soft, compressible.
3. Principle: The role of heat conduction. In use, the air between the electronic components and the heat sink can be exhausted to achieve sufficient contact between the heating surface and the heat dissipation surface, so that the heat conduction effect is more obvious.
 
Thermal conductive silicone sheet application LED lamp, LED lamp types:

For indoor LED lights, thermally conductive materials with relatively weaker thermal conductivity are generally used, which can reduce the cost of the product and meet the needs of the product itself. For some outdoor high-power LED lights, such as street lights, the power of street lights is much higher than other indoor lights. In order to better dissipate the heat of the lamp and increase the service life of the lamp, a thermal conductive material with relatively good thermal conductivity is generally used, mostly LED thermal conductive silicone sheet.
 
Compared with other thermal conductive products, thermal silica film has advantages:
The performance is more stable and the heat conduction is good. It is mostly used for heat conduction of high-power products, with its own micro-viscosity, and convenient operation. It can be directly pasted between the aluminum base plate and the heat sink of the LED lamp, and the degree of adhesion is high, so that the heat conductive sheet and the aluminum base plate are fully contacted, exhaust air, and better conduct heat out through the heat sink. This greatly reduces the heat of the lamp itself, thereby prolonging the service life of the lamp.
